A Look at How to Buy Quality Used Cars

If you are thinking about replacing a current vehicle you may want to think about buying used cars instead of new ones. There are a number of advantages to purchasing cars that are used rather than new but there can also be issues that you need to be aware of before you make your ultimate selection. Here are some things that you need to keep in mind and tips on how to make the process much less difficult.

The reason that used cars often make a great alternative to new cars is that a new car will lose much of its value the instant it is driven off of a car lot. If you want to make sure that you are getting the most for your money, a used vehicle may be the one that is best for you. However if you are not careful about the car that you purchase and end up with a vehicle that has many problems it may not be the best investment after all.

You can find used vehicles online and at car lots. You can also find vehicles through private sales and these are often advertised in classified advertisements in magazines and newspapers. You need to decide where you are willing to purchase a car from. Some people prefer to deal with a car dealership and other people prefer a private sale. You can apply the same car buying tips to any purchase but there may be some advantages to buying from a car dealership.

One of the first things that you should look at is the year that the car was made. Remember that cars are made with a model year that is generally one year ahead of the current calendar year. Therefore a car that has a model year the same as the calendar year has actually been around for one year. This can help you factor in how old the car is. It can also be helpful to ask when the car was actually manufactured. A good car dealer should be able to tell you this information.

Also look to see how much the car has been driven. The odometer can give you an idea of whether it has been driven a lot or a little. The more it has been driven the more wear and tear there is on the car. You want your used cars to last as long as possible so a lower odometer reading is often a better choice. Also ask whether it has been driven in the city or on the highway. City driving is often more stressful on a car because of the stops and starts.

When inspecting the vehicle, look for signs that it may have been repainted to hide damage. Checking in the wheel wells and around the doors will help you do this. Look for signs of paint spatter that may mean that it was repainted. If you see signs that they may have been trying to hide damage it doesn't mean that you should not buy that car but it does mean that you may want to be careful and ask more questions than if a car seems to be in good condition.

If you are purchasing a used car, see if you can get an extended warranty. This is often available through car dealerships rather than through independent sellers. An extended warranty will help pay for repairs if there is a massive problem such as a cracked engine block. It will drive up the price although it can help if you end up needing a major repair that you would not be able to afford.

Remember that used cars are plentiful and if you shop around you may be able to get a great deal. You should be willing to negotiate to see if you can get a better price and if you are willing to do so, you may end up getting a wonderful car for a lot less than it would cost to purchase it new.

When you are buying a used automobile there are simply certain things that you need to check for to be sure that you are getting a good car that will not break down shortly after purchase. First you need to test drive and then park the auto. Do not be afraid to get your hands and feet dirty because you are going to have to crawl on the ground to see if there are any spots of leaked oil on the ground.

A lot of cars will leak water and or coolant and this is the sign of a car that will quickly die after purchase. Once again you are going to have get dirty by crawling on the ground. Take the car on a bit of a long test drive and then once again find a nice level place to park it. Be sure to crawl under and check for water spots (not coming from the ac) and also check the coolant reservoir under the hood for shortages.

When buying a new used car there are certain things that the owner must do to be able to upkeep it. Regular maintenance must be performed by the owner, just like clockwork. Be sure to change your oil every three thousand miles or three months, which ever occurs first. Also keep in mind that you should get a tune up every thirty thousand miles as well.

Information You Should Consider Before Looking at Used Cars

When looking at used cars with the intent of acquiring one it is wise to define what you will need in a car that you purchase. For example consider how you will use the car, how many people you will need to transport, the length of your commute, the type of driving you do, and the gas mileage. Thus the car you choose should be the one that suits your needs rather than the one that looks really good.

Some of other things that you should ask yourself pertain to the vehicle's features. Such as the following: How much cargo space do you require? Do you really need four wheel drive? What kind of safety features do you require to feel safe when driving? Will the car fit in the spot you will park it in? How about the seats? Do you need them to recline because of a bad back?

Another important consideration is the price and the monthly payments. How much can you realistically afford? What kind of down payment can you raise? Some advise that a reasonable monthly payment should be no more than about 20 percent of the salary that you take home.

Once you have considered and decided upon all the factors, features, and other incidental items you require in a car that you will purchase then it is time to do some research. Study the different classes of cars and what they offer to their drivers. Then decide which class is right for you and then look at the models that are available in your price range.

During the time that you are doing your research, especially if its online, take note of the dealers in your area. Get in touch with those that have cars that you are interested in. Ask questions about the car to gain information about the car that you may not have been able to discern through the listing on the web page.

After you have finished your research it is time to actually go out and take a look at a car. When you are looking at a car that interests you be sure to look it over carefully. Check for flaws such as dents, bumps, and signs of rust. Make sure that all the locks work and that the fuel cap fits correctly. Look underneath the car to see if there are any oil leaks or water leaks. Take a look at its maintenance history as well as it will tell you a great deal about the car.

Another area that you should check is the interior. Does the wear seem consistent with the mileage? If not then something is not right and you should not consider it for purchase any longer. The next items that should be inspected are the steering wheel, brake pedal, and accelerator pedal. If the accelerator pedal shows a lot of wear then it is a good indicator of the actual mileage.

Looking at used cars for purchase can be confusing. What is worse is that you know that many of the sellers and salesmen that you encounter will not be entirely honest with you. After all their goal is to sell the car for a profit. So be cautious and study the car in question from its engine to its tailpipes to ensure you get a true bargain.

What Are Gas Bicycle Motors?

As the green movement begins to branch out and reach more and more people, the topic of gas bicycle motors keeps coming up, especially in conversations about ways to contribute to a healthier environment by investing in the most economic friendly products. A gas bicycle motor is basically the motor mechanism as a whole of a motorized bicycle, which combines the components of a motorcycle with that of an ordinary push pedal bicycle.

When was the Gas Bicycle Motor Invented?

To many it might seem as though the notion of powering a bicycle by adding a gas bicycle motor to the frame of a traditional bicycle is a relatively new invention. The fact is that experimenters began working diligently to find a way to power the first bicycles quickly after the idea of the first bicycle was conceived in Paris in the 1860s and was fulfilled by the addition of pneumatic tires and the chain drive by 1888 thanks to the work of John Dunlop. By the end of the 19th century, experimenters had found a way to add a steam engine to the bicycle.

From there, the imaginations of anxious inventors everywhere began to turn and the early progression of the bicycle split into two distinctly different categories: the motorcycle and motorized bicycles, which is where we are today. Motorcycles are exclusively powered by their engines, are much heavier than the traditional bike, and are treated as motor vehicles. These motorcycles require a valid driver’s license to operate them and are required to follow all the rules associated with driving and traffic laws. Motorized bicycles, however, are basically comprised with the frame from a regular pedal-powered bike and gas bicycle motors, which are added on to assist with the pedaling. These bicycles are not considered street legal and do not require a driver’s license in most areas, nor do they require the driver to obey the same traffic laws which apply to motor vehicles.

What Types of Motors Typically Come in these Bicycle Gas Motor Kits?

There are several different types of motors that can be used to convert an ordinary bicycle into a motorized bicycle. For example, there are two stroke, four stroke, and electric motors available, depending upon the desire of the rider. A two stroke engine is the most basic design and requires the rider to use a mixture of gas and oil, which should be mixed prior to riding the bike. A four stroke engine is a little easier to ride and does not require the oil and gas mixture. The life of these motors tends to be a little longer. Finally, electric motors are definitely quieter and have a little more power than gas motors. They can also be powered by using different voltages.
